LineSpacingStyle Пример

Sub Example_LineSpacingStyle()
    ' Этот пример создает объект MText в пространстве модели и затем
    ' находит LineSpacingStyle для объекта.
    
    Dim MTextObj As AcadMText
    Dim corner(0 To 2) As Double
    Dim width As Double
    Dim text As String
    corner(0) = 0#: corner(1) = 10#: corner(2) = 0#
    width = 10
    text = "Это - текст String для Объекта mtext"

    'Создает Объект mtext
    Set MTextObj = ThisDrawing.ModelSpace.AddMText(corner, width, text)
    ZoomAll
    
    'Найдите текущий LineSpacingStyle
    Dim currStyle As Integer
    currStyle = MTextObj.LineSpacingStyle
    MsgBox "LineSpacingStyle для объекта MText: " & currStyle
    
    'Измените LineSpacingStyle
    MTextObj.LineSpacingStyle = acLineSpacingStyleExactly
    MsgBox "LineSpacingStyle для объекта MText: " & MTextObj.LineSpacingStyle
    
    'Сбросьте LineSpacingStyle
    MTextObj.LineSpacingStyle = currStyle
    MsgBox "LineSpacingStyle для объекта MText: " & MTextObj.LineSpacingStyle
    
End Sub
Сайт управляется системой uCoz